I have recently acquired a Peavey Valverb
the unit is 120V 60hz
Has anyone on here converted one
successfully to work in the UK
on 230V 50hz

www.mustardallegro.co.uk

Sorry, cant help cause I bought a 230v version. I guess you would need to replace the transformer but a much simpler solution would be a 110v to 230v external step down transformer.
